Abstract

The utility model relates to the technical field of microphones, in particular to a microphone fixing seat frame. Comprising a counterweight base and an adjusting mechanism, and the adjusting mechanism comprises a limiting seat, a rotating shaft, a supporting plate, a limiting plate, a connecting seat, an adjusting screw rod, an adjusting knob, a stabilizing device and a height adjusting device. The working height of the microphone body can be adjusted through the height adjusting device, the vertical position of the adjusting screw rod is adjusted through the adjusting knob, and the rotation adjustment of the limiting seat is realized under the cooperation of the supporting plate and the rotating shaft, so that the working angle adjustment of the microphone body can be realized; therefore, the problems that the angle of the microphone cannot be adjusted according to the use condition when an existing microphone support is used, and the use is inconvenient can be solved.

Description

TECHNICAL FIELD

[0001] The utility model relates to microphone technical field, concretely relates to a microphone fixing seat frame. BACKGROUND

[0002] Most of the existing microphone support cannot be fixed after adjusting the height of the microphone, and since some microphones are heavy, the height of the support will be lowered after installing the microphone on the support, which will affect normal use.

[0003] The prior art CN216649918U discloses a microphone support for network live broadcast, which comprises a microphone support body, a fixed mounting block is fixedly installed at the bottom end of the microphone support body, a first limiting telescopic rod is fixedly installed at the top end of the microphone support body, a second limiting telescopic rod is inserted into the first limiting telescopic rod, an internally threaded sleeve is arranged at the top end of the microphone support body, and a rotating block is fixedly installed on the surface of the internally threaded sleeve. The utility model is provided with a fixed mounting block and a microphone fixing seat, the microphone is inserted into the circular groove at the top end of the microphone fixing seat and clamped and fixed by the first clamping block and the second clamping block, the microphone fixing seat can slide up and down by rotating the rotating block, and the height of the microphone fixing seat can be adjusted in this way.

[0004] However, the above-mentioned support has the following problems in actual use: the microphone can only be adjusted in height, and cannot be adjusted in angle according to the use condition, which is inconvenient to use. UTILITY MODEL CONTENTS

[0005] The utility model aims at providing a microphone fixing seat frame to solve the problem that the existing microphone support cannot adjust the angle of the microphone according to the use condition and is inconvenient to use.

[0006] To achieve the above-mentioned purpose, the utility model adopts the following technical scheme: the utility model provides a microphone fixing seat frame, which comprises a counterweight base, an anti-skid pad is arranged at the bottom of the counterweight base, and further comprises an adjusting mechanism.

[0007] The adjusting mechanism comprises a limiting seat, a rotating shaft, a supporting plate, a limiting plate, a connecting seat, an adjusting screw, an adjusting knob, a stabilizing device and a height adjusting device, the limiting seat is arranged above the counterweight base, the microphone body is detachably installed on the limiting seat, and the top of the limiting seat is provided with an abutting threaded knob, the rotating shaft is integrally formed with the limiting seat and symmetrically arranged on both sides of the limiting seat, the supporting plate is symmetrically arranged, and the bottom of the supporting plate is connected to the top of the height adjusting device on both sides and rotatably connected with the rotating shaft, the limiting plate is arranged between the supporting plates, the connecting seat is fixed to the bottom of the limiting seat, the circular ring at the top of the adjusting screw is fixed in the mounting groove of the U-shaped mounting portion of the connecting seat through a T-shaped pin shaft, and the bottom outer threaded end penetrates through the limiting plate, the adjusting knob is threadedly connected with the adjusting screw and symmetrically arranged on both sides of the limiting plate, the stabilizing device is arranged on both sides of the supporting plate, and the height adjusting device is arranged on the side of the counterweight base close to the supporting plate.

[0008] The stabilizing device comprises a first stabilizing block and a second stabilizing block, the first stabilizing block is welded on one side of the supporting plate and connected with the height adjusting device, and the second stabilizing block is symmetrically arranged with the first stabilizing block and welded on the supporting plate and connected with the height adjusting device.

[0009] The height adjusting device comprises a fixing disc and a connecting assembly, the fixing disc is detachably connected with the counterweight base and located on the side of the counterweight base away from the supporting plate, and the connecting assembly is arranged on the side of the fixing disc close to the supporting plate.

[0010] The connecting assembly comprises an adjusting threaded cylinder and a matching frame, the adjusting threaded cylinder is integrally formed with the fixing disc and located above the fixing disc, and the bottom outer threaded end of the matching frame is threadedly connected with the adjusting threaded cylinder, and the top plate is respectively connected with the supporting plate, the limiting plate, the first stabilizing block and the second stabilizing block through bolts.

[0011] The connecting assembly further comprises an anti-loosening knob, the anti-loosening knob is threadedly connected with the matching frame and can abut on the top end face of the adjusting threaded cylinder.

[0012] The utility model discloses a microphone fixed seat frame, first unscrewing the abutment threaded knob of the limiting seat top when using, then the tail part shell of microphone body is inserted in the cooperation cavity of limiting seat, further, the abutment threaded knob is screwed down to realize microphone body installation, the overall counterweight is formed through the counterweight base, avoids the dumping caused by the gravity of microphone body, the working height of microphone body can be adjusted through height adjusting device, the vertical position of adjusting screw is adjusted through the adjusting knob, and the rotation adjustment of limiting seat is realized under the cooperation of support plate and pivot, thereby can realize the working angle adjustment of microphone body, and then can solve the inconvenient problem that the microphone support of prior art cannot adjust the microphone angle according to the use condition when using. DETAILED DESCRIPTION

[0018] In order to make the person skilled in the art can better understand the utility model, the utility model technical scheme is further explained below in conjunction with the drawings and examples.

[0019] Example one:

[0020] As Figure 1 And Figure 2 Shown, wherein Figure 1 It is the overall structure schematic drawing of microphone fixed seat frame, Figure 2It is the structural schematic view of adjusting screw rod 107, the utility model provides a microphone fixed seat frame: including counterweight base 101 and adjusting mechanism, the adjusting mechanism includes limit seat 102, pivot 103, support plate 104, limit plate 105, connecting seat 106, adjusting screw rod 107, adjusting knob 108, stabilizing device and height adjusting device, the stabilizing device includes first stabilizing block 111 and second stabilizing block 112, the height adjusting device includes fixed disc 113 and connecting assembly, the connecting assembly includes adjusting screw thread cylinder 114 and cooperation frame 115. Through the foregoing scheme, the existing microphone support can be adjusted according to the use condition when using the microphone angle, and the use is not convenient, can understand, the foregoing scheme can be adjusted according to the use condition when using the microphone angle.

[0021] In the embodiment, the bottom of the counterweight base 101 is provided with a non-slip pad. The non-slip pad is arranged to improve the stability of the counterweight base 101. Alternatively, the non-slip pad can be replaced by a suction cup.

[0022] The limiting seat 102 is arranged above the counterweight base 101, the microphone body 109 is detachably installed on the limiting seat 102, and the abutting screw knob 110 is arranged on the top of the limiting seat 102; the rotating shaft 103 is integrally formed with the limiting seat 102 and is symmetrically arranged on both sides of the limiting seat 102; the supporting plate 104 is symmetrically arranged and connected at the bottom to both sides of the top of the height adjusting device and is rotationally connected with the rotating shaft 103; the limiting plate 105 is arranged between the supporting plates 104; the connecting seat 106 is fixed to the bottom of the limiting seat 102; the annular part at the top of the adjusting screw 107 is fixed to the mounting groove of the U-shaped mounting part of the connecting seat 106 through the T-shaped pin shaft, and the bottom outer threaded end penetrates through the limiting plate 105; the adjusting knob 108 is threadedly connected with the adjusting screw 107 and is symmetrically arranged on both sides of the limiting plate 105; the stabilizing device is arranged on both sides of the supporting plate 104; and the height adjusting device is arranged on one side of the counterweight base 101 close to the supporting plate 104. The limiting seat 102 is provided with a matching cavity for inserting the tail part of the shell of the microphone body 109, and the abutting screw knob 110 is arranged on the top of the matching cavity for abutting and locking after installation; the rotating shaft 103 is integrally arranged on both sides of the limiting seat 102; the stepped part of the rotating shaft 103 is mounted on the supporting plate 104 through a rotating bearing; the through hole through which the adjusting screw 107 passes is arranged on the limiting plate 105 and is fixed by a bolt arranged from bottom to top; the rectangular plate part of the connecting seat 106 is connected with the limiting seat 102 through a bolt; the mounting groove is arranged on the U-shaped end part of the connecting seat 106, and the penetrating hole is arranged on the side wall of the mounting groove; the top of the adjusting screw 107 is an annular part, which is mounted on the connecting seat 106 through a T-shaped pin shaft to rotate; the limiting nut is mounted on the stepped outer threaded end part away from the limiting disc of the T-shaped pin shaft; the bottom outer threaded end part of the adjusting screw 107 penetrates through the matching hole on the limiting plate 105, and then the adjusting knob 108 is mounted; the stabilizing device is used to improve the working stability of the supporting plate 104; and the height adjusting device is used to adjust the working height of the microphone body 109.

[0023] Secondly, the first stabilizing block 111 is welded on one side of the support plate 104 and connected with the height adjusting device; the second stabilizing block 112 is symmetrically arranged with the first stabilizing block 111 and welded on the support plate 104 and connected with the height adjusting device. The first stabilizing block 111 and the second stabilizing block 112 are both triangular, one side end of each is welded on the support plate 104, and the other side end bottom is provided with a threaded hole, so as to be fixed by the bolt arranged from bottom to top. The first stabilizing block 111 and the second stabilizing block 112 increase the connecting point on the bottom of the support plate 104 after being arranged, which is beneficial to improve the working stability of the support plate 104.

[0024] Then, the fixed disc 113 is detachably connected with the counterweight base 101 and located on the side of the counterweight base 101 away from the support plate 104; the connecting assembly is arranged on the side of the fixed disc 113 close to the support plate 104. The fixed disc 113 is installed in the stepped groove of the counterweight base 101 through a countersunk bolt, and the connecting assembly is used to realize the connecting assembly cooperation.

[0025] Finally, the adjusting threaded cylinder 114 is integrally formed with the fixed disc 113 and located above the fixed disc 113; the bottom outer threaded end of the matching frame 115 is threadedly connected with the adjusting threaded cylinder 114, and the top plate is bolted with the support plate 104, the limiting plate 105, the first stabilizing block 111 and the second stabilizing block 112. The bottom of the adjusting threaded cylinder 114 is integrally formed with the fixed disc 113, and a vertical threaded cavity is arranged inside, so as to arrange the outer threaded end of the bottom of the matching frame 115. The through hole is arranged on the top plate of the matching frame 115, so as to be bolted from bottom to top with the support plate 104, the limiting plate 105, the first stabilizing block 111 and the second stabilizing block 112.

[0026] To address the inconvenience of using existing microphone stands where the microphone angle cannot be adjusted according to usage, this invention addresses the issue of microphone holders being inconvenient to use. First, loosen the abutting threaded knob 110 on the top of the limiting seat 102. Then, insert the tail housing of the microphone body 109 into the mating cavity of the limiting seat 102. The corresponding control buttons for the microphone body 109 are located on the end face of the tail cover plate of its housing. Next, tighten the abutting threaded knob 110 to install the microphone body 109. Finally, the counterweight base 101 provides overall weight distribution to prevent the microphone body 109 from being subjected to excessive weight. 09. The microphone body 109 can be adjusted by rotating the mating bracket 115 to change the mating distance between it and the adjusting screw cylinder 114. The vertical position of the adjusting screw 107 can be adjusted by the adjusting knob 108, and the rotation adjustment of the limiting seat 102 can be achieved with the cooperation of the connecting seat 106, the support plate 104 and the rotating shaft 103. This allows for the adjustment of the working angle of the microphone body 109, thereby solving the problem that existing microphone brackets cannot adjust the microphone angle according to the usage situation, which is inconvenient.

[0027] Example 2:

[0028] like Figure 3 As shown, where Figure 3 This is a schematic diagram of the overall structure of the microphone mounting bracket. Based on the first embodiment, this utility model provides a microphone mounting bracket. The connecting component further includes an anti-loosening knob 201, which is threadedly connected to the mating bracket 115 and can abut against the top end face of the adjusting threaded cylinder 114.

[0029] In this embodiment, the outer ring array of the anti-loosening knob 201 is provided with anti-slip protrusions, and it can be directly installed on the bottom of the mating frame 115. When the mating frame 115 needs to be rotated, the anti-loosening knob 201 can be loosened in advance. After the mating frame 115 has been rotated and adjusted, the anti-loosening knob 201 is rotated and pressed against the top end face of the adjusting threaded cylinder 114, thereby achieving the anti-loosening treatment of the mating frame 115.
